How they compare
United States of America currently reports 3.7 against 3.26 in Argentina, a difference of 0.44.
That makes United States of America's figure about 1.1 times Argentina's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 17 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Argentina ahead.
Argentina ranks 32nd and United States of America ranks 29th of 79 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 2 and United States of America in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Argentina | United States of America |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 14.73 | 4.15 | 10.59 | Argentina |
| 2010s | 5.91 | 5.19 | 0.7213 | Argentina |
| 2020s | 3.33 | 3.7 | 0.37 | United States of America |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
